| Removal |
| 1. |
Turn ignition switch OFF and disconnect the battery negative (-) terminal.
|
| 2. |
Remove the drive belt.
(Refer to Engine Mechanical System - "Drive Belt")
|
| 3. |
Disconnect the air compressor connector (A) and the alternator connector
(B), and remove the cable (C) from alternator "B" terminal.
|
| 4. |
Loosen the mounting bolts (A).
|
| 5. |
Remove the alternator.
|
| Installation |
| 1. |
Install in the reverse order of removal.
|
| 2. |
Adjust the alternator belt tension after installation.
(Refer to Engine Mechanical System - "Drive Belt")

| Disassembly |
| 1. |
Remove the rear cover (A) after removing nuts.
|
| 2. |
Remove the mounting bolts (A) and the brush holder assembly (B).
|
| 3. |
Remove the slip ring guide (A) after pulling it.
|
| 4. |
Remove the OAP cap.
|
| 5. |
Remove the OAP pulley (A) using the special tool.
|
| 6. |
Unsolder the 3 stator leads (A).
|
| 7. |
Remove the 4 through bolts (A).
|
| 8. |
Disconnect the rotor (A) and bracket (B).
|
| Reassembly |
| 1. |
Reassemble in the reverse order of disassembly.

| Inspection |
| 1. |
Check that there is continuity between the slip rings (C).
|
| 2. |
Check that there is no continuity between the slip rings and the rotor
(B) or rotor shaft (A).
|
| 3. |
If the rotor fails either continuity check, replace the alternator.
|
| 1. |
Check that there is continuity between each pair of leads (A).
|
| 2. |
Check that there is no continuity between each lead and the coil core.
|
| 3. |
If the coil fails either continuity check, replace the alternator.
